Why Internal Tooth Lock Washer is necessary?

I use an internal tooth lock washer when I need a fastener to stay tight under vibration or movement. The teeth bite into the mating surface and help resist loosening, which gives me more confidence that the connection will remain secure over time. This is especially useful in assemblies where regular washers may not provide enough grip.

From my experience, it also helps improve the hold between the screw head and the surface by creating extra friction. I find this valuable in applications where a small amount of movement could cause problems, such as electrical connections, machinery, or equipment that is frequently handled. It adds a simple layer of protection without making the assembly complicated.

I also like that it is easy to install and cost-effective. When I want a practical solution for better locking performance, an internal tooth lock washer is one of the simplest choices I can make.

My Buying Guides on Internal Tooth Lock Washer

What I Look for First

When I buy an internal tooth lock washer, I first think about where I’m using it. I want the washer to grip well, keep the fastener from loosening, and fit the job properly. For me, the most important things are size, material, tooth strength, and whether it matches the bolt or screw I’m using.

Understanding the Purpose

I use internal tooth lock washers when I need extra resistance against vibration and loosening. The inner teeth bite into the fastener head and the mating surface, which helps keep things secure. In my experience, they work best in applications where space is limited and I need a low-profile locking solution.

Choosing the Right Size

I always check the inner diameter, outer diameter, and thickness before buying. If the washer is too small, it won’t fit properly. If it’s too large, it may not lock effectively. I make sure the washer matches the screw or bolt size exactly so I get a tight, reliable hold.

Material Matters

I pay close attention to the material because it affects durability and corrosion resistance. For general indoor use, I may choose plain steel. For outdoor or damp environments, I prefer stainless steel because it resists rust better. If I’m working in a demanding setting, I look for washers made from stronger or coated metals.

Tooth Design and Grip

The tooth design is one of the first things I inspect. I want sharp, evenly formed teeth because they provide better locking action. If the teeth look weak or uneven, I usually skip that product. In my experience, better tooth quality means better performance over time.

Check Compatibility with the Surface

I always think about the surface where the washer will sit. Internal tooth lock washers need enough surface contact to bite in properly. If the surface is too soft or too smooth, I make sure the washer is still appropriate for the material. I also avoid using them where I don’t want visible marking or damage.

Corrosion Resistance

If I expect moisture, chemicals, or outdoor exposure, I choose a washer with good corrosion resistance. Stainless steel is usually my first choice in these cases. I’ve learned that a washer can only do its job well if it stays in good condition over time.

Load and Application Requirements

I consider how much stress the fastener will face. For light-duty jobs, a standard washer may be enough. For machinery, electrical assemblies, or vibration-prone applications, I look for a washer that is designed for stronger locking performance. I always match the washer to the demands of the project.

Quality and Standards

I prefer buying washers that meet recognized standards or come from trusted manufacturers. This gives me more confidence in consistency, dimensions, and performance. In my experience, low-quality washers can fail to grip properly or wear out faster than expected.

Packaging and Quantity

I also think about how many I need. If I’m doing a small repair, a small pack is fine. For repeated use or larger projects, I buy in bulk to save time and money. I like packaging that keeps the washers organized and protected from damage or rust.

My Final Buying Tip

When I choose an internal tooth lock washer, I focus on fit, material, tooth quality, and the environment it will be used in. If I get those basics right, I usually end up with a washer that performs well and keeps the fastener secure.
